As seen in The New York Times, on NPR, and the TODAY Show, Man of the Year is the #1 friendship podcast in the country! Comedians and friendship experts Matt Ritter and Aaron Karo will help you make new friends, reconnect with old ones, and build lifelong social fitness. Each November they award a gigantic Man of the Year trophy to one of their childhood friends – a tradition that has kept their crew going strong since the '80s. But the country is facing a friendship recession – 15% of men report having zero close friends – and they’re on a mission to change that with tips, hacks, and decades of hilarious stories. Matt and Karo head home to celebrate the 22nd year of the greatest friendship ritual on Earth: the Man of the Year dinner at Peter Luger Steakhouse. A crew of friends from second grade, one annual winner, and a trophy etched with names for life. At its core, it’s about how tradition anchors friendship and removes the guesswork. That’s why we’re such big believers in creating your own ritual.

Instead of trying to turn complete strangers into friends, we recommend starting with “fringe friends” – acquaintances you already kinda know. Karo and Matt discuss where to find fringe friends and how to turn them into binge friends – buddies you see all the time.

Karo and Matt introduce the PALS test: a simple framework for evaluating whether a friendship truly serves you. The guys break down the four pillars—passion, appreciation, loyalty, and support—and explain how each reveals the strength of your connection.
